Q: Is 1,359,344 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,359,344 is a composite number.

Why is 1,359,344 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,359,344 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 16 28 53 56 106 112 212 229 371 424 458 742 848 916 1,484 1,603 1,832 2,968 3,206 3,664 5,936 6,412 12,137 12,824 24,274 25,648 48,548 84,959 97,096 169,918 194,192 339,836 679,672 and 1,359,344, with no remainder.

Since 1,359,344 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,359,344, it is a composite number.
